- The distance between Chon Buri/ Sattahip, Thailand and Monrovia, Liberia is approximately 12,128 km or 7,536 mi.
- To reach Chon Buri/ Sattahip in this distance one would set out from Monrovia bearing 73.5° or ENE and follow the great circles arc to approach Chon Buri/ Sattahip bearing 101.6° or ESE .
- Chon Buri/ Sattahip has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w) whereas Monrovia has a tropical monsoonal climate (Am).
- The average annual temperature is 2.2 °C (3.9°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 1.5 °C (2.7°F) more in Chon Buri/ Sattahip.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to extremely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 3309 mm (130.3 in) less which is equivalent to 3309 l/m² (81.21 US gal/ft²) or 33,090,000 l/ha (3,537,541 US gal/ac) less. About 2/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 1.8° lower in Chon Buri/ Sattahip than in Monrovia.
